    so you need a gain of 100, with an op-amp.

    http://www.radio-electronics.com/inf...-inverting.php

    just put the resistors value in the formula, and you're ready to go.

    Your op-amp may/will have a dc offset, you'll need to compensate it in software. TL072 is not a rail-to rail one and will not work @5V (from what I remember of), so you'll need to use a higher voltage rail to make it work properly, or use a rail-to-rail one.
